Epidemiologic Characteristics of Patients Undergoing Genital Reconstruction Operations for Gender Reassignment, Detroit: 1984–2008
Unique patient variables (n=82) | Female-to-male reassignment (n=39) | Male-to-female reassignment (n=43) |
---|---|---|
Age (years) (mean±SD) | 39.1±9.9 | 39.9±9.9 |
Race | ||
Caucasian | 27 (69.2) | 29 (67.4) |
African-American | 6 (15.4) | 13 (30.2) |
Marital Status | ||
Single | 29 (74.4) | 38 (88.4) |
Married | 8 (20.5) | 2 (4.7) |
Divorced | 2 (5.1) | 3 (7.0) |
Height (cm) (mean±SD) | 166.4±6.3 | 176.8±8.0 |
Weight (kg) (mean±SD) | 77.4±14.3 | 80.3±20.4 |
BMI (mean±SD) | 28.1±5.6 | 25.7±6.0 |
Number of procedures (mean±SD)a | 21.2±8.6 | 12.9±6.6 |
Number of operating-room encounters (mean±SD)b | 11.8±4.7 | 4.9±2.4 |
ASA score at first admission | ||
Score 1 | 2 (5.1) | 3 (7.0) |
Score 2 | 36 (92.3) | 39 (90.7) |
Score 3 | 1 (2.6) | 1 (2.3) |
Mean±SD | 2.0±0.3 | 2.0±0.3 |
Charlson Comorbidity Index score at first admission (mean±SD) | 0.2±1.0 | 0.6±1.5 |
Number of patients with SSI | 34 (87.2) | 9 (20.9) |
Culture of SSI obtained | 31 (91.2) | 5 (55.6) |
Number of cultures confirming SSI | 31 | 5 |
Coagulase-negative staphylococci | 18 (58.1) | 2 (40) |
Enterococcus faecalis (VSE and VRE) | 12 (38.7) | 0 (0) |
Corynebacterium species | 13 (41.9) | 1 (20) |
Pseudomonas aeruginosa | 10 (32.3) | 2 (40) |
Escherichia coli | 10 (32.3) | 1 (20) |
Enterobacter species | 3 (9.7) | 0 (0) |
Candida species | 2 (6.5) | 2 (40) |
Staphylococcus aureus (MSSA and MRSA) | 2 (6.5) | 0 (0) |
Streptococcus species | 2 (6.5) | 1 (20) |
Stenotrophomonas maltophilia | 2 (6.5) | 0 (0) |
Klebsiella species | 2 (6.5) | 0 (0) |
Citrobacter freundii | 1 (3.2) | 0 (0) |
Enterococcus faecium (VSE and VRE) | 1 (3.2) | 0 (0) |
Enterococcus species | 1 (3.2) | 1 (20) |
Serratia marcescens | 1 (3.2) | 0 (0) |
Culture Site | ||
Wound | 13 (41.9) | 3 (60) |
Tissue | 6 (19.4) | 1 (20) |
Perineum | 5 (16.1) | 1 (20) |
Penis | 3 (9.7) | 0 (0) |
Groin | 4 (12.9) | 0 (0) |
Data are no. (%) of patients unless otherwise indicated.
Procedure: Surgical intervention performed in the operating room. An operating-room encounter may encompass more than one procedure.
Operating-room encounter: Any visit to the operating room.
ASA score=American Society of Anesthesiologists score; BMI=body mass index (kg/m2); MRSA=meth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us; MSSA=methicillin-sensitive Staphylococcus aureus; SSI=surgical site infection; VRE=vancomycin-resistant enterococci; VSE=vancomycin-susceptible enterococci.
